Revision as of 12:00, 26 September 2014

Biblical GN 1. An ancient Near Eastern land (2 Nephi 21:11 = Isaiah 11:11)

Etymology

SHINAR is the name of an ancient land mentioned in the ISAIAH section of the Book of Mormon but not mentioned as a separate PN or GN in the Book of Mormon.

Variants

Deseret Alphabet: 𐐟𐐌𐐤𐐇𐐡 (ʃaɪnɛr)
